Mrs. Roxie Ann Burns

Sunrise: August 27, 1953 - Sunset: September 9, 2024

Mrs. Roxie Ann Burns passed away on the morning of September 9,2024 at her home which she shared with her husband of 33 years, and was surrounded by her family. Roxie was born August 27, 1953 here in the city of Winston-Salem. Roxie was a high school graduate of Parkland High School . Entering into the workforce and completing additional years in the medical field allowed her to make her way to Baptist Hospital, now known as Atrium Health Wake Forest Baptist Hospital, where she spent 28 years before her retirement in the staff of the Respiratory and Telemetry Departments. Roxie was able to take advantage of and enjoy some of life's pleasures such as taking rides to see speed racers at Piedmont and Farmington Speedways, being adventurous taking on deep sea fishing. She developed a technique of playing Jewel Quest on her iPad , watching Family Feud and "laughing with Steve Harvey", watching Walker Texas Ranger and those "good old Westerns". Roxie was a supportive , loving member of Pilgrim Rest Baptist Church in all her ways until her passing . Roxie " the baby of 9" was preceded in death by her parents, Mr. John Henry and Mrs. Rebecca Benson; her siblings, Mrs. Mary Jordan, Mr. Bernard Benson and Mr. Leroy Benson.
